- ABSTRACT: In the present paper, Osthol (molecular formula: C15 H16 O3 ; molecular mass: 244) was obtained from the plant Prangos pabularia by column chromatography technique. This compound was simultaneously exposed to short- (254 nm) and long-wavelength (365 nm) ultraviolet (UV) radiations for different time periods. These irradiated samples were characterized by UV–Visible spectroscopy. No significant variation in optical absorbance/transmittance in broad (200–365 nm) spectrum is observed with increasing dose. The effect of temperature on optical absorption is also insignificant. Effect of UV radiation and temperature on optical band gap ( Eg ), Urbac energy, or disorder energy ( Eu ) was also analyzed. A small impact on these optical parameters ( Eg and Eu ) was observed. This molecule seems very stable (at molecular level) under the influence of UV radiations and temperature. These observed properties shown by this compound projects it as a potential UV protection material.
